Chester A. ‘Chet’ Whitten Jr.

Chester A. “Chet” Whitten Jr., 94, a resident of Milford, NH died at his home after a period of declining health on July 25, 2021, just ten days after the death of his loving wife, Joan.

He was born in Wilton, NH on August 7, 1926, a son of the late Chester A. Whitten, Sr. and Christine (Thompson) Whitten.

Chet was raised and educated in Milford and graduated from Milford High School, Class of 1944. Following graduation, Chet entered the United States Army serving in World War II and was honorably discharged in November of 1946 with the rank of Sergeant.

He had been employed in various road construction crews, Milk Plant Manager for Hayward Farms and later operated the family sawmill on Whitten Road until he retired in 1986. Over the years Chet maintained and upgraded their three family home, only recently allowing contractors to assist.

Chet married Joan (Anderson) and together made their home in Milford where they raised their three sons.

He enjoyed bowling, skiing, golfing, traveling, and socializing with family and friends.

In addition to his wife, he was predeceased by his granddaughter, Kayla Whitten.

Survivors include three sons, Gary Whitten and his wife, Patte of Phoenix, Arizona, Jeffrey Whitten of Blackstone, MA, and Peter Whitten and his fiancé, Wendy Foss of Dover, NH; a grandson, Keith Whitten, of Washington, DC; several nieces and nephews.
